The Efficacy of Antiviral Components from Plant Products against Herpes Simplex Virus Type 1

HSV-1 is the leading transmittable cause of blindness in the United State and the developed countries of the world. HSV-1 establishes lifelong latency in the TG and is associated with high morbidity and mortality in humans worldwide. Currently, there is no method available to eliminate latent HSV-1 from an infected individual. Several FDA approved anti-HSV-1 drugs, such as Acyclovir, Valancyclovir, Famcyclovir and Pencyclovir are available for treatment. However, widespread use of these nucleoside analogues produces drug resistant HSV-1 mutants that cause more severe infections. Also these drugs have no ability to prevent latency/recurrences. To find a cure for this devastating disease, cost effective natural antivirals that prevent resistance development with reduced toxicity are of immediate need. A wide variety of plants are being studied as a source of natural products that can result in the development of novel drugs. Several compounds from these sources have shown high levels of antiHSV-1 activity. However, development of antivirals from these herbal sources has not been completely explored. Recently, we have tested the efficacy of partially purified component(s) from regular and pearl garlic (PG) against HSV-1 in vitro. The compound(s) from pearl garlic extracts have shown strong antiviral efficacy against wild type HSV-1 and ACV resistant HSV-1 mutants as compared to regular garlic. About 70% of the ACV resistant TKHSV-1 replication was inhibited by the isolated components from PG. Active constituents from this plant product may provide useful lead to the development of new and effective antiviral agent(s) against HSV-1. In the current review, the findings from this study along with some of the most promising compounds from herbal sources having anti-HSV-1 activity will be described.
